Output 34290c24aa596c4f9287b89d26d2d0a5dff7a9d8cc0e63daa2b30be478550bcf:0

value
118125941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f91d8c7ef18f4bd84dc92922fca9542db3bebff OP_EQUAL
address
3En9Gb7E4oMMmWWDJfD66JEigN7dJEbXaQ
transaction
34290c24aa596c4f9287b89d26d2d0a5dff7a9d8cc0e63daa2b30be478550bcf
confirmations
229694
spent
true